XS8R.L vs. SMGB.L
XS8R.L (Xtrackers MSCI Europe Information Technology ESG Screened UCITS ETF 1C) and SMGB.L (VanEck Semiconductor UCITS ETF) are both exchange-traded funds - XS8R.L is a Technology Equities fund tracking the MSCI World/Information Tech NR USD, while SMGB.L is a Semiconductors fund tracking the MSCI World/Information Tech NR USD. Both are passively managed. Over the past 5 years, XS8R.L returned -0.59%/yr vs 38.39%/yr for SMGB.L. A 0.69 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. XS8R.L charges 0.20%/yr vs 0.35%/yr for SMGB.L.
